Toy Chest and Bench Plans
$9.95

Build this EASY combination Toy Chest and Bench from these plans. Paint it, stain it or varnish it - either way, this toy chest will have your kids putting their toys away with a smile!. Simple to make and fun to decorate using decals, stencils, decoupage* or paint ! Toy chest shown was done with colorful animal decals, but you are only limited by your imagination.

Features: Only six pieces, all cut from a 4x6 piece of 3/4in. plywood. Make from inexpensive fir plywood. Hinged lid (bench seat) allows access to toy storage below. Child-approved type lid supports (to prevent the lid from falling closed). Casters for easy moving.

Size: 32in. long by 20in. deep by 24in. tall (to top of backrest). From floor to seat is 13in. tall.

Plans Include: Assembly instructions, full-size traceable patterns for most wooden parts, materials list, plywood cutting layout and 3D exploded assembly diagram. NOTE: Plans do not include colorful animal decals shown in picture.

Skill Level: Basic woodworking skills required.
